在某些情况下,我们需要从外网通过路由器访问内网的数据库。以下是一个使用SQL语句实现此目的的教程。
配置路由器
首先,需要在路由器中配置端口转发规则,将外网访问路由器特定端口的流量转发到内网数据库服务器的特定端口。端口转发规则通常在路由器的设置页面中进行设置。
建立数据库连接
配置好端口转发后,即可使用SQL语句建立数据库连接。语法如下:
CONNECT TO <服务器地址>:<转发端口> AS <用户名> IDENTIFIED BY '<密码>';
其中:
* <服务器地址>为内网数据库服务器的IP地址或域名。
* <转发端口>为路由器端口转发规则中指定的端口。
* <用户名>和<密码>为数据库的用户名和密码。
执行SQL查询
建立数据库连接后,即可执行SQL查询语句来访问和操作数据库数据。例如:
SELECT * FROM <表名>;
该语句将从指定的表中选择所有行和列。
注意事项
需要注意以下事项:
* 确保在路由器中设置了正确的端口转发规则。
* 确保内网数据库服务器允许来自外网的连接。
* 使用防火墙规则或其他安全措施来保护内网数据库免受未经授权的访问。